HairsprayBabe · 08/02/2018 10:14

Well 2 eggs and 1 tbsp of oil = about 270-300 cals depending on the oil being used, then the rest is green veg which obviously varies per portion to between 200 cals for edamame and 9 cals for marrow - if you class 100g as a portion I probably have about a 500g - a kilo of green veg a day, depending on what I am eating.

So most of the stuff this week has been between 10-35 cals per 100g so I am probably eating about 150-350cals of veg on top of the 600 for eggs and oil. (plus an extra 70 for the boiled egg I have for breakfast, never really want much else(

So
B - boiled egg(70) and milky coffee(40) - 110 cals
L - 2 eggs 1 tbsp fat (300) and spinach (50ish) and celery (35) - 385cals
D - 3 eggs 1 tbsp of fat (370) and 3 or 4 portions of green veg (140ish) - 510

Makes 1005 for the day, so not as low as I was expecting, but I just don't lose on anything over 1200 because I hate the exercise part of losing weight!
